Seven firemen are currently responding to treatment at the St. Dominic Catholic Hospital in Akwatia and the Kade Government Hospital after the fire engine in which they were on board was involved in an accident at Adankrono while they were responding to an accident scene at Otwenkwanta.

Personnel on duty received a call to respond to an accident around 08:37 hrs on Sunday morning after a fuel tanker fell off the road at Otwenkwanta, the tender and personnel who were immediately dispatched to the scene 08: 38 hrs while negotiating a curve after the Gaso filling station got involved in the accident.

It is unclear what caused the accident but preliminary investigations suggest a reported steer lock caused the accident, 8 personnel were on board the fire engine with registration number FS 438 at the time of the accident with one person escaping unhurt.

Five of the personnel were rushed to the St. Dominic Hospital in Akwatia while the driver and the duty officer were rushed to the Kade Government Hospital.

The Eastern Regional Fire Service Commander ACFO Jennifer Naa Yarley Quaye who visited the personnel at both hospitals and the accident scene allaying fears said all personnel are in stable conditions and responding to treatment.
